Forest deptt closes 4 projects in 2005, staff gets wages for sitting idle | Jangal main mangal | | Arun Singh Early Times Report jammu, Oct 8: The Forest department shut down four of its projects in 2005, but the staff employed continue to receive wages for sitting idle. The department had started the projects under Integrated Watershed Development Programme (IWDP) with an aim to harnessing, conserving and developing degraded natural resources such as soil, vegetative cover and water. These projects were however closed in 2005, but the staff working in the projects was not repatriated and continued to stay there. "With the closure of four projects in 2005 under the IWDP all the assets created under the project were handed over to Territorial Forest department," sources said, adding that around 300 officers who were assigned the job of implementation of the projects were not repatriated. This means the staff has got crore of rupees from 2005 till date. The department is yet to take up the issue of the adjustment of the idle staff. Pertinently the main objective of this programme was for the development of waste lands in non-forest areas, checking of land degradation, putting such waste land into sustainable use and increasing bio mass, availability of fuel wood, fodder and restoration ecology etc. |
